在两台机器上分别安装了MSDE,并且在其中的一台上建立了数据库作服务器用。
不知道为什么从另外一台机器访问数据库时,提示拒绝访问,能够看到服务器。在服务器上设定时有什么需要注意的地方吗?

解决方案 »

  1.   

    兄弟,你在安装之前为什么不好好看一下它自带的“MSDE2Ksp3aReadMe.htm”文件?里面说的清清楚楚。
    MSDE默认是不允许其他机器和它建立连接的。
    如果你希望其他机器能和它建立连接,必须在Setup.ini文件里或命令行后边加上:
    DisableNetworkProtocols=0 
      

  2.   

    兄弟,根据您的方法,我重新安装了msde,还是访问不了。在另外一台上用msde可以看到服务器的名称,但是禁止访问。
      

  3.   

    装msde的机器上有没有防火墙什么的,将其停掉试试.
      

  4.   

    权限设定没有问题。
    在服务器端里面我追加了一个用户,这个用户必须使用客户端的windows用户名和该用户的密码吗?
    本机连接数据库的时候,只用通过windows longin认证,sql server的认证就被通过了。所以不需要另外设置用户。通过网络访问的时候,应该需要另外设定用户吧。这个用户的信息应该如何设定呢。
    这个问题折磨了我一天,明天去买一本书看看。